1. Answer :
2/3 ÷ -7/6
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
-7/6 ----> reciprocal ----> -6/7
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 2/3 by -6/7.
(2/3) x (-6/7)
Step 3 : Simplify
(2/1) x (-2/7)
Step 4 : Multiply
(2/1) x (-2/7) = -4/7 Positive times negative equals negative
So,
2/3 ÷ -7/6 = -4/7
2. Answer :
-2 ÷ 8/3
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
8/3 ----> reciprocal ----> 3/8
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 2 by 3/8
(-2) x (3/8)
Step 3 : Simplify
(-1) x (3/4)
Step 4 : Multiply
(-1) x (3/4) = -3/4 Positive times negative equals negative
So,
-2 ÷ 8/3 = -3/4
3. Answer :
9/5 ÷ 3
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
3 ----> reciprocal ----> 1/3
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 9/5 by 1/3.
(9/5) x (1/3)
Step 3 : Simplify
(3/5) x (1/1)
Step 4 : Multiply
(3/5) x (1/1) = 3/5 Positive times positive equals positive
So,
9/5 ÷ 3 = 3/5
4. Answer :
One quarter = 1/4
Number of quarters in 8 :
= 8 ÷ (1/4)
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
1/4 ----> reciprocal ----> 4
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 8 by 4.
8 x 4 = 32 Positive times positive equals positive
There are 32 quarters in 8.
5. Answer :
One half = 1/2
Number of halves in 7 :
= 7 ÷ (1/2)
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
1/2 ----> reciprocal ----> 2
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 7 by 2.
7 x 2 = 14 Positive times positive equals positive
There are 14 halves in 7.
6. Answer :
Three-fourth = 3/4
Number of three-fourths in 6 :
= 6 ÷ (3/4)
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
3/4 ----> reciprocal ----> 4/3
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 6 by 4/3.
6 x (4/3)
Step 3 : Simplify
2 x (4/1)
Step 4 : Multiply
2 x (4/1) = 4 Positive times positive equals positive
There are 4 three fourths in 6.
7. Answer :
One-fifth = 1/5
Number of one-fifths in 10 :
= 10 ÷ (1/5)
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the second rational number.
1/5 ----> reciprocal ----> 5
Step 2 :
Multiply the first rational number 10 by 5.
10 x 5 = 50 Positive times positive equals positive
There are 50 one-fifths in 10.
8. Answer :
To find how far she should travel in each descent, we have to divide 100 by 5.
Step 1 :
Take the reciprocal of the divisor 5.
5 ---- reciprocal ----> 1/5
Step 2 :
Multiply 100 by 1/5
(100) x (1/5)
Step 3 : Simplify
(20) x (1/1)
Step 4 : Multiply
(20) x (1/1) = 20
So, she should travel 20 feet in each descent.
